Master of Urban & Regional Planning (MURP) at University of South Florida Fees
The fee structure for the Master of Urban and Regional Planning (MURP) at the University of South Florida covers the first-year tuition fees along with other additional charges, including the Books and supplies charges; facilities cost and many more offered by the University of South Florida. Other than tuition costs, students need to pay living expenses that cover various factors like rent, food, transportation, utility, and other personal expenses. The average cost of living is USD 12,996. The total tuition fees for the first year of Master of Urban and Regional Planning (MURP) is USD 24,060.

Master of Urban & Regional Planning (MURP) at University of South Florida Highlights
- The University of South Florida's Master of Urban and Regional Planning program is housed in the School of Public Affairs, which is a part of the College of Arts and Sciences
- The Master of Urban and Regional Planning program at USF takes great pride in the achievements and successes of its students and alumni
- The MURP is a 48 credit hour professional degree program that prepares students for careers, or advanced research and academic pursuits, in urban and regional planning
